The UK job market is experiencing a surge in demand for professionals with expertise in predictive maintenance for smart manufacturing systems. Here are some of the most sought-after roles and their relative prevalence: 1. **Predictive Maintenance Engineer** - 45% Predictive Maintenance Engineers are responsible for developing and implementing predictive maintenance strategies using AI and IoT technologies, ensuring optimal performance and minimal downtime of manufacturing systems. 2. **Smart Manufacturing Systems Specialist** - 30% Smart Manufacturing Systems Specialists focus on the seamless integration of various digital tools, such as machine learning algorithms, IoT sensors, and data analytics platforms, to enhance manufacturing efficiency and productivity. 3. **Data Scientist (Predictive Maintenance Focus)** - 20% Data Scientists with a focus on predictive maintenance use advanced statistical techniques and machine learning models to analyze vast amounts of data generated by manufacturing systems, predicting equipment failures before they occur. 4. **Industrial IoT Solution Architect** - 5% Industrial IoT Solution Architects design and implement end-to-end IoT solutions, integrating hardware, software, and communication protocols to enable real-time data collection, analysis, and decision-making in smart manufacturing environments. These roles require a solid foundation in data analysis, machine learning, and IoT technologies, as well as a deep understanding of the manufacturing industry and its unique challenges.
